How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Harmon Gardens?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Harmon Gardens Studio Apartments | $1,161 | $625 | $1,475 |
Harmon Gardens 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,291 | $855 | $4,828 |
Harmon Gardens 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,581 | $976 | $4,678 |
Harmon Gardens 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,788 | $1,385 | $2,844 |
Harmon Gardens 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,953 | $1,925 | $1,985 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Harmon Gardens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Harmon Gardens?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Harmon Gardens with Swimming Pool is at Quail Ridge listed at $625.
How much is the average rent for Harmon Gardens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Harmon Gardens with Swimming Pool is $1,349.
What is the largest Harmon Gardens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Harmon Gardens is a 1,883 square feet unit starting from $1,675 at Las Vegas Grand.
What is the average size for Harmon Gardens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Harmon Gardens is currently at 569 sq ft.
